San Diego Residents Express Frustration Over Frequent I-5 Closures

San Diego, CA – Local lawmakers are demanding answers from state transportation and law enforcement agencies following a series of prolonged closures on Interstate 5 (I-5) that have significantly disrupted daily commutes and travel plans for San Diego County residents.

Recent I-5 Closures and Public Outcry

Since September, stretches of I-5 have been temporarily shut down for planned or emergency closures at least once a month. The most recent incident occurred on December 5, when a person threatening to jump from the Del Mar Heights Road bridge led to full and partial lane closures for approximately eight hours. This followed a 12-hour closure in Oceanside on November 22 due to a law enforcement pursuit and shooting, and a complete closure near Camp Pendleton on October 5 for a military demonstration. Each of these closures took place on Fridays or Saturdays, prime times for motorists traveling to and from San Diego for weekend getaways or local residents heading to Los Angeles or Orange counties.

Legislators’ Response

In response to these disruptions, three state senators, four assemblymembers, and San Diego City Council President Joe LaCava have signed a letter addressed to Caltrans Director Dina El-Tawansy, California Highway Patrol Commissioner Sean Duryee, and San Diego Police Department Chief Scott Wahl. The letter expresses concern over the unintended consequences of the December 5 shutdown, noting that parents were unable to pick up children from childcare, individuals missed flights, and workers faced challenges commuting to and from their jobs. The lawmakers emphasized the profound negative ripple effects that occur when a major transportation artery like I-5 is closed.

Call for Improved Coordination and Communication

The legislators highlighted the need for greater clarity regarding the management of freeway closures, decision-making processes during incidents, expeditious reopening of freeway operations, and public communication strategies. They proposed the feasibility of mass text message communications to inform the public about freeway closures in real time. The letter also underscored the importance of balancing public safety with minimizing disruptions to daily life.

Background Context

Interstate 5 is a critical transportation corridor for San Diego County, facilitating daily commutes, tourism, and regional connectivity. Prolonged closures not only inconvenience residents but also have broader economic and social implications. The recent series of closures has intensified discussions about the need for improved infrastructure management, emergency response coordination, and transparent communication with the public to mitigate the impact of such incidents.
